Possible Causes of Water Damage in Lakewood Homes
Water damage can occur in Lakewood homes due to a variety of factors. Common causes include severe weather conditions such as heavy rainstorms and melting snow, which can overwhelm drainage systems and lead to indoor flooding. Additionally, plumbing failures—like burst pipes or leaking fixtures—are often responsible for water intrusion inside homes. These issues can develop gradually or suddenly, causing extensive damage if not addressed promptly.
Another frequent cause is appliance malfunctions, such as faulty washing machines or water heaters. Poor maintenance or aging equipment can lead to leaks that go unnoticed until significant damage occurs. Structural issues, like roof leaks or foundation cracks, can also allow water to seep into your home’s interior, especially during storms or high humidity seasons. Recognizing the source of water intrusion early can help prevent long-term damage and mold growth.

What types of water classification do you handle?
We categorize water damages into three main types: clean water from broken pipes or rain, gray water such as from appliances or minor leaks, and black water, which includes contaminated sewage or floodwaters. Proper classification is critical to ensure safe and effective cleanup. Our experts are trained to handle all types of water damage cases.
